Seasonal Fruits Add Year-Round Variety

The key to making pancakes and waffles fit easily into year-round menus is using seasonal fruits. Strawberries, blueberries, raspberries, blackberries, peaches and cherries are ideal choices during the spring and summer; pears, apples and cranberries are equally delicious additions during the fall and winter. Just remember, the tastiest fruit is probably what is in season and will also be the least expensive. Bananas are a good choice year-round.

Simple fruit and citrus sauces make a nice complement to pancakes and waffles. Wonderful Waffles with Fresh Fruit and Luscious Lemon Sauce is a delicious recipe. There are lots of easy sauces that can be made with fruit juices. Use your imagination to create your own fruit sauces the same way you would for desserts, ice cream or pound cake.
